Threats Connected With LASIK
Lots of individuals going through LASIK surgical procedure are mostly worried about possible risks related to the treatment. While LASIK is a safe and reliable therapy for vision Correction, like any operation, it does come with some dangers.
The most usual threats associated with LASIK consist of dry eyes, glare, halos, and difficulty driving at night in the instant postoperative duration. These symptoms are typically short-term and enhance as the eyes recover.

Qualification Misconceptions
Some people erroneously think that just individuals with severe vision issues are qualified for LASIK surgery. Nonetheless, this is a common mistaken belief. While LASIK is usually related to dealing with high degrees of n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ism, people with milder vision problems can also be qualified prospects. In fact, developments in LASIK innovation have actually increased the range of treatable prescriptions, enabling more individuals to benefit from the treatment.
LASIK eligibility is established via a comprehensive eye exam by a certified eye doctor. Variables such as corneal density, eye health, and general medical history play an essential function in assessing an individual's viability for the surgical procedure.
